Transaction 86570946a33bc36172595a4d94501b2180c1c952b5f2df7b8967d3fb228de4ea

1 Input
2 Outputs
  • 86570946a33bc36172595a4d94501b2180c1c952b5f2df7b8967d3fb228de4ea:0
  • value  1105513
    address  3KXhyvBLcHUdmzr1b6cUgxzDuL497JZESy
  • 86570946a33bc36172595a4d94501b2180c1c952b5f2df7b8967d3fb228de4ea:1
  • value  44491399
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x